Vareli Village Overview

Vareli is a village in Chiplun tehsil of Ratnagiri district, Maharashtra. It lies about 38 km from Chiplun tehsil headquarters and around 150 km from Ratnagiri district headquarters. As per available records (2009), Murtawade is the Gram Panchayat for Vareli village.

Village Location & Administration

As per Census 2011, the village code of Vareli is 565318. The village covers a geographical area of 623.66 hectares. Chiplun is the nearest town, located about 38 km away.

Vareli village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head of the village. For political representation, the village falls under the Guhagar Vidhan Sabha constituency and the Raigad Lok Sabha constituency. Population & Demographics of Vareli

This section provides population and demographic details of Vareli village as per Census 2011, including gender-wise and social category-wise data.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 437 189 248
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 41 20 21
Scheduled Castes (SC) N/A N/A N/A
Scheduled Tribes (ST) N/A N/A N/A
Literate Population 265 144 121
Illiterate Population 172 45 127

Key population details of Vareli village are given below:

  • Vareli village is a small village with a total population of around 437, including approximately 189 males and 248 females, with a sex ratio of 1312 females per 1,000 males.
  • The number of children aged 0–6 years in the village is relatively low.
  • The literacy level of Vareli village is good, with a literacy rate of about 60.64%.
  • There are around 128 households in Vareli village.

Transport & Connectivity of Vareli

Transport facilities help residents of Vareli village travel to nearby towns for work, education, healthcare, and daily needs. The village has access to public bus service, private bus service and a rail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within village
Private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
